Vedanta Aluminium achieves improvement in water resource management

Vedanta Aluminium, the largest aluminum producer in India, recycled 12.5 billion liters of water as of February during the fiscal year 2022-23.

A groundbreaking ceremony for a new Sewage Treatment Plant with a daily processing capacity of 440 kiloliters was held at its aluminum smelter in Jharsuguda. After the plant is put into operation, the water treated by the facility will be reused within the plant, which can reduce 15 crore liters of water consumption each year.

Vedanta Aluminium has succeeded in achieving steady improvements in water resource management by deploying a strategic combination of resource conservation and source rejuvenation programs.
